Locating Yellow Metal with the Leading Detectors
Serious prospectors need reliable tools, and when it comes to hunting precious metal, the device is paramount. Several models truly stand out from the crowd. For deep ground penetration and discriminating between yellow metal and other minerals, the Garrett GPX series consistently receives high praise. Alternatively, if you're working in challenging environments like extremely mineralized ground, a robust detector like the Minelab M6 is a excellent option. Don’t overlook inexpensive options either; the Garrett ACE series offer incredible performance for the price. Ultimately, the “superior” device depends on your spending limit and the type of soil you'll be exploring.
Locating Gold Nuggets with a Detector
Serious treasure seekers know that a metal detector specifically designed for gold nugget detection is an absolute necessity. Unlike models geared towards relic discovery, these specialized instruments boast enhanced sensitivity to the faint signals produced by small gold particles. Evaluate features like very low frequency operation, ground balance capabilities, and discrimination settings to boost your chances of unearthing valuable treasure. Purchasing the right gold finder can change your prospecting endeavor and significantly increase your haul of precious gold nuggets.

Your Gold Device Purchase Guide
Choosing the best gold detector for a requirements can feel overwhelming, but this overview aims to clarify the selection. Consider the variety of terrain you'll be gold detector searching – heavily forests benefit robust units, while small rivers may demand a submersible build. Moreover, be aware of the distinction between VLF and PI methods; VLF is usually suited for larger gold nuggets, while PI performs in highly mineral earth. Don't forget to factor in budget, since detectors extend considerably in value.
